The SMARTer Ultra Low RNA Kit for Illumina Sequencing has been designed and validated to prepare cDNA samples for sequencing on all of Illumina's sequencing instruments, including HiSeq™ 2000. This kit greatly reduces handling of the RNA sample, thereby minimizing the risk of sample loss and preserving the original message. The efficient incorporation of known sequences at both ends of the cDNA during first strand synthesis enables researchers to perform the entire protocol in a single tube, without a separate adaptor ligation step. Moreover, SMART's high efficiency and sensitivity permits the use of very limited quantities of starting material—as little as 100 pg of total RNA—from a variety of sources. The combination of SMART technology's ability to handle very small quantities of RNA with Illumina's unique combination of long and short reads, single and paired-end sequencing, and capacity for tens of millions to billions of reads per run allows you to annotate coding SNPs, discover transcript isoforms, characterize splice junctions, and determine the relative abundance of transcripts from even the smallest samples.
